Conn. Practice Book § 7-6 — Filing of Papers

Rule text

No document in any case shall be filed by the clerk unless it has been signed by counsel or a self-represented party and contains the title of the case to which it belongs, the docket number assigned to it by the clerk and the nature of the document. The document shall contain a certification of service in accordance with Sections 10-12 through 10-17, and, if required by Section 11-1, a proper order and order of notice if one or both are necessary.
